Amyris, Michelin partner to commercialize isoprene

October 5, 2011 |

In California, Amyris and Michelin have signed a definitive agreement to collaborate in the development and commercialization of Amyris’ renewable isoprene, a chemical building block in rubber tires and other products that use synthetic and natural rubbers.  Under the agreement, Amyris and Michelin will partner to contribute funding and technical resources to develop Amyris’ technology to produce isoprene from renewable feedstocks.

Amyris expects to begin commercializing this isoprene in 2015 for use in tire and other specialty chemical applications such as adhesives, coatings and sealants. Michelin is committed to off-take volumes on a ten-year basis. In addition, Amyris retains the right to market its renewable isoprene to other customers.
